Abstract

Objective: Many studies reported an improved prognosis in patients with Burkitt's lymphoma obviating the need of stem cell transplantation. However, prognosis of the advanced disease [i.e. Burkitt's cell leukemia (BCL)] has not been reported with current treatment modalities except for a few prospective trials. The aim of this study is to compare the prognoses of BCL patients with similarly treated and nontransplanted patients with other types of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) and with ALL patients that underwent allogeneic stem cell transplantation (ASCT) in their first remissions.
